Abstract:
For implementation of pseudo-random number generators (PRNG), a linear congruential generator (LCG) is the most frequently used algorithm. The techniques to increase the efficiency of the LCG based on 64-bit integers and bit-wise operations are studied. The efficiency of the LCG implementation with the techniques proposed is experimentally tested.
